Financial solutions firm Waterfield Enterprises LLC accused Zephyr Management LP of infringing its trademark by using a similar name for its Zephyr Waterfield US Funds LLC unit.
Zephyr’s use of the mark is an “obvious attempt to trade on Waterfield’s goodwill,” the company said in a complaint filed Wednesday in the US District Court for the District of Delaware. Parent company Zephyr Management and Zephyr Wealth LLC are also listed as defendants.
